What Certifies As Emergency AC Repair in Morse Bluff, NE?
Some ac unit breakdowns are inconvenient, however they might wait till routine organization hrs to be dealt with. On a hot summertime day, you may need rapid a/c repair to bring back comfort as well as safety. The adhering to are several of the most common reasons customers contact us for emergency air conditioner repair:
My Air Conditioning Unit Will Not Activate: You have an emergency if you are not able to chill your residence as a result of an HVAC breakdown. To begin, make sure that no circuit breakers have actually been tripped and that the outside condensing device is incorporated. If these troubleshooting steps are inefficient, call our professionals for help.
My air conditioning activates however isn’t cooling: Make certain the thermostat is readied to “ automobile” rather than “on” prior to requiring an emergency air conditioning repair. If this doesn’t function, there may be a trouble with the compressor or a reduced cooling agent fee, both of which our air conditioning repair technicians can promptly figure out.
My air conditioning is making Strange sounds or weird smells: You have actually probably heard what your air conditioning system seems like after years of running it. Uncommon working, yelling, or ticking noises originating from the outdoors system or air trainer might indicate a trouble. Likewise, stuffy smells might recommend hazardous mold and mildew development in the air conditioning unit, while a burning smell may signal an electric issue. Prior to you switch on the ac system once again, make certain these worries are fixed.
My AC maintains shutting down: This may be short-cycling. When the a/c operates briefly before shutting off, it could be because of a obstructed filter or a damaged thermostat. Short-cycling usually require the existence of a expert. Our personnel will recover appropriate operation to ensure that your air conditioning system can do its work.

A Better Refrigerant For Air Conditioners And The Environment
A lot of air-conditioners and heatpump offered all over the world utilize a refrigerant called R-22. Emissions of R-22 are thought about by some professionals to be a considerable consider diminishing the ozone layer that secures animals and individuals from damaging rays from the sun.
Families now have the option to ask for an air-conditioner or heatpump that utilizes a more efficient and environmentally friendlier refrigerant called 410A or R-410 when buying a new system for their home.
If your system ever leaks, the escaping refrigerant won't contribute to ozone deficiency! Why cannot R-410A affect the ozone layer? R-410A is not a CFC or an HCFC.
When your system requires to be fixed in a few years, you avoid the risk that R-22 might become tough or expensive to get. The old refrigerant R-22 will be phased out along with other ozone depleting chemicals, and both supply and demand of this chemical will be considerably affected by present and upcoming guidelines. By picking an a/c unit or heatpump that utilizes R-410A, you will prevent the danger associated with purchasing a product that is destined to end up being obsolete.
The heart of every air conditioner or heat pump is the compressor, and more recent systems are specifically created to use R-410A refrigerant. R-410A can soak up and launch heat more effectively than R-22 ever could, compressors with R-410A run cooler than R-22 systems, decreasing the risk of burnout due to overheating.
R-22 air conditioners use an oil understood as "mineral oil" that has actually been used for decades. R-410A air conditioners utilize newer artificial lubricants that are usually more soluble with the R-410A than the old mineral oils are with the older R-22 refrigerants. Just as lots of brand-new cars and trucks use artificial oils due to the fact that they are less most likely to break down under high stress and heat, the new artificial oils utilized in R-410A air conditioners are less most likely to break down under severe conditions.
R-410A records heat and then releases it much better than R-22 did, so manufacturers have actually found that they require less refrigerant in an R-410A air conditioner than they needed in an R-22 air conditioner. The bad news was that R-410A couldn't be utilized in air conditioners that were made to utilize R-22, however the advantages for new air conditioners were too terrific to pass up.
It's apparent that air conditioning unit made for using R-410A are more effective, more dependable, and may even be less pricey then the older systems that still use R-22. Compare the SEER or EER ratings and the ENERGY STAR rating to be sure.

Changing The Air Conditioner Filter: How Frequently Should You Do It?
If you wish to extend the life expectancy of your air conditioning unit and make sure that it works at its finest, there are a number of things that you need to do. Once in every three to 6 months, the very first and the most important thing for you to do is change the filter of your air conditioner or heater.
The interval of filter changes would depend upon numerous points, like the kind of your home. Do not postpone the modification of filters for too long, as it would just depreciate the efficiency of your device, and would bring up the business expenses. Once again, too regular filter modifications would be a large waste of money!
Keep in mind, that if your ac system has an efficient filter, you would have to clean and change it all the more. The majority of individuals find pleated filters adequate for them. These have an efficiency of ten to sixty percent, though some companies state that their filters are a lot more efficient.
The pleated filters need to be changed as soon as in every three to six months. You need to make the replacement within 3 months if your locality has a high level of dust.
If you want a filter that has the maximum effectiveness, go for an electrostatic, electronic or HEPA filter. These filters are more reliable, therefore you would have to change them more regularly.
The electrostatic filters potentially have the best mix of efficiency and value. You would initially have to pay practically 2 to six times more than a regular throwaway filter, however ultimately it would be more cost effective as these filters can be cleaned and recycled simply by washing.
Even if the electronic filters are filthy, they do not obstruct the circulation of air. When they are filthy, they lose their capacity of draining dust out of the air and simply stop working appropriately. You would then have to dry and tidy the electronic cells by soaking them in HVAC cleaner options.
If you are searching for the most effective filters, HEPA filters are what you want. You can ask your conditioner contractor whether your machine requires this type of filter.
Your hardware store can supply you with the more financial panel filters at 10 dollars for a pack of 4. These filters are really so inferior in their functioning, that you shouldn't be surprised if even after one year of installing it to your conditioner, you discover that its not yet filthy sufficient to be changed.
